Bought a VAG com and got the following:

3 Faults Found:

00603 - Footwell/defroster Flap Positioning Motor (V85)

37-00 - Faulty

01271 - Positioning Motor for Temperature Flap (V68)

37-00 - Faulty

01274 - Air Flow Flap Positioning Motor (V71)

37-00 - Faulty

I canot beleive all three motors have blown at once. Could there be a wiriing / connector issue or is there a fuse to be checked ?

Try resetting the motors

Flap Motor Reset

08 Heater/A.C

04 Basic settings

Channel 000 (30 Secs)

001 (30 Secs)

002 (30 Secs)
